Abstract

Limited proportion of open space compared to building area on house-lots in housing district is suspected a trend in Indonesian housing. Several contiguous housing in Sidoarjo Regency, Indonesia, comprises of low-to-medium and medium-to-high class housing was studied to learn on the trend. It concluded that 100% respondents were significantly proven to have insufficient private open space toward 0%. The study proved that respondents possess sufficient awareness but limited knowledge on the necessity of private open space.
